Job Description
We are seeking a compassionate and organised individual to join our team as a Practitioner Assistant.
This role is about supporting our Child-to-Parent Abuse (CPA) Practitioners to ensure parents and carers receive timely, high-quality support. You'll play an important role in managing referrals, coordinating communication with families, providing day-to-day administrative support, and helping deliver workshops and practical resources for parents.
Our service is focused entirely on supporting parents and carers experiencing abuse from their children (we do not provide direct support to children or young people).
You don't need previous experience in counselling or domestic abuse services - we provide full training and ongoing support. What matters most is that you are IT proficient, organised, compassionate, proactive, and enjoy helping people behind the scenes as well as working directly with families.
This role is an excellent opportunity for someone looking to build experience in family support, administration within the third sector.
